Even if you live far away from your nearest Costco location, getting a Costco membership can still be worth it. That’s because Costco is not just for weekly grocery trips or eating hot dogs at the food court — it’s an everything store, with great deals on online shopping and big-ticket items like furniture and appliances.

Let’s look at a few reasons why Costco membership is worth it, even if you rarely go to the local warehouse.

4. Costco services: Travel, auto sales, home contractors

Costco has special pricing on valuable services that can make your home — or your next vacation — better.

Costco Home Services

Need to find a contractor for your next home improvement project? Trust Costco. Costco can connect you with reliable, vetted local contractors for projects like bath remodeling, cabinet refacing, solar panel installations, flooring, and more.

Costco Travel

Costco Travel is like a built-in travel agency for Costco members. You can use Costco Travel to get special deals on vacations, especially for cruises and all-inclusive package resort deals.

Costco Auto Program

The Costco Auto Program gives you special Costco member pricing on new or used vehicles from participating partner dealerships. If you want a no-haggle process, this could be worth trying for your next car purchase.
